RunDisney 2020 at Disneyland® Paris

Is 2020 your year to get fit? It’s time to put on your trainers as this year, there will be not just one but two Disneyland® Paris Run Weekends that are sure to provide fun for the whole family.

 

You’ll have the chance to enjoy a brand-new runDisney experience as we will see the first ever Disneyland® Paris Princess Run, from 8th to 10th May. Across this weekend there will be a selection of races for runners of all ages and fitness levels, limited-edition medals, professional photographers and the chance to meet Disney Characters. If you need a little longer to train, then a breathtaking celebration of running awaits at the Disneyland Paris Run Weekend 5th Anniversary Edition, from 24th to 27th September 2020. Guests of all ages can get set to celebrate a magical running milestone. You’ll run through Disney® Parks and straight into a dream come true! When you runDisney, you’ll experience spectacular runs through Disney® Parks on the most amazing courses on Earth.
